There’s a 24 hour fitness nearby (it’s the “stadium” one). There’s at least three of us who compete at powerlifting who go there and they’ve always been really good about letting me use chalk (I clean up afterward) and pretty much generally do whatever I need to do. They even have round metal plates instead of the hex ones.
Downside is that it’s mostly dudes and it’s old and smelly. My wife went once and said “your gym sucks but everyone is there to do work”. There’s also only one powerrack and one squat rack but typically I can get in on those.
But I haven’t been to the gym on campus so don’t know what they have for equipment.
